Curso Ansible with Linux and Windows Administration

  • DevOps | CI | CD | Kubernetes | Web3

Curso Ansible with Linux and Windows Administration

24 horas
Visão Geral

Este  Curso Ansible with Linux and Windows Administration valida a capacidade dos profissionais de gerenciar diversos sistemas por meio de uma ferramenta de automação de código aberto chamada Ansible. Este curso cobre conceitos essenciais como automação de tarefas, orquestração, provisionamento de nuvem e implantação de aplicativos. O Ansible permite que administradores gerenciem sistemas Linux e Windows em larga escala com a mesma ferramenta, reduzindo a complexidade e aumentando a eficiência. Esta formação é amplamente reconhecida nos setores de TI por seu impacto na administração de sistemas. O setor industrial utiliza esta certificação como padrão para contratar administradores de sistemas, pois garante sua habilidade na redução de custos de infraestrutura da empresa, melhorando a consistência do sistema e simplificando implantações complexas.

Principais empresas que contratam Ansible com profissionais certificados em administração de Linux e Windows

  • Grandes empresas como IBM, Accenture, Deloitte, Oracle, Red Hat, Cisco e muitas outras contratam extensivamente profissionais com certificações Ansible, Linux e Windows Administration. Eles exigem esses profissionais para diversas funções, como administradores de sistema, engenheiros de DevOps, engenheiros de TI e muito mais, devido à expansão de sua infraestrutura digital.
Objetivo

Após relizar este Curso Ansible with Linux and Windows Administration com êxito você será capaz de:

  • Este Curso Ansible with Linux and Windows Administration tem como objetivo fornecer aos alunos uma compreensão proficiente do Ansible, uma ferramenta de provisionamento de software de código aberto, gerenciamento de configuração e implantação de aplicativos. Os participantes adquirirão conhecimento sobre como escrever infraestrutura como código, melhorando assim os fluxos de trabalho operacionais. 
  • O Curso Ansible with Linux and Windows Administration também inclui uma compreensão abrangente da administração de Linux e Windows, envolvendo os alunos com configurações de sistema, competência em linha de comando e gerenciamento de servidores. 
  • Além disso, os participantes aprenderão a automatizar tarefas administrativas em sistemas abrangentes com Ansible, com foco no uso de Ansible Tower e Ansible Container, e aproveitarão as melhores práticas para segurança de rede.

Depois de concluir o treinamento de certificação Ansible com Linux e Administração do Windows, um indivíduo deve ter adquirido habilidades na implementação de estratégias de gerenciamento de configuração básicas a avançadas, automatizando atualizações de sistema e instalações de software e gerenciando infraestruturas de servidores em grande escala. Eles terão um conhecimento profundo dos módulos, manuais e funções do Ansible, bem como da administração de sistemas Linux e Windows. O conhecimento adicional inclui técnicas de codificação de infraestrutura, orquestração e automação com linha de comando Ansible.

Publico Alvo
  • Administradores de sistema responsáveis ​​por automatizar o gerenciamento da infraestrutura de TI.
  • • Profissionais de TI interessados ​​em aprender técnicas de automação e orquestração.
  • • Desenvolvedores que desejam entender e usar o Ansible para automação.
  • • Entusiastas de tecnologia que desejam atualizar suas habilidades de automação com Ansible.
  • • Administradores Linux e Windows experientes que buscam melhorias em processos de infraestrutura.
Materiais
Inglês + Exercícios + Lab Pratico
Conteúdo Programatico

Introduce Ansible

  1. Introduction to Ansible
  2. Current IT Automation State
  3. Configuration Management
  4. Ansible History
  5. How Ansible Works?

Understanding of Ansible Framework

  1.  Case Study
  2. Ansible way of Configuration Management
  3. Infrastructure as a Code (IaC)
  4. Idempotency
  5. Ansible Terminologies

Ansible Deployment

  1.  Pre-requisites for Controller Node
  2. Installation and Configuration
  3. Ansible Configuration File
  4. Pre-requisites for Managed Node
  5. Ansible Inventory
  6. Ansible Communication
  7. Ansible Architecture

 Ad-hoc Commands

  1. Introduction to Ansible Module
  2. Ad-hoc Remote Executions
  3. Ansible Commands
  4. Privilege Escalation

Managing Playbooks

  1. YAML Structure
  2. Ansible Playbooks
  3. Structure of Playbook
  4. Syntax Check of Playbook
  5. Run Playbook

Variables in Ansible

  1. Introduction to Ansible Variables
  2. Defining Ansible Variable in Ansible Code
  3. Use Variable File
  4. Host Vars and Group Vars
  5. Ansible Facts
  6. Facts in Playbooks
  7. Use Cases of Facts 
  8. Disabling Facts

Conditionals, Loops, Handlers and Error Handling 

  1. Conditionals in Ansible
  2. Loops in Ansible
  3. Loops with Variables
  4. Notify and Handlers in Ansible
  5. Register and Debug
  6. Ignore Errors
  7. Block and Rescue

Ansible Roles and Galaxy 

  1. Introduction to Role
  2. Understanding Role Structure
  3. Managing Roles
  4. Introduction to Ansible Galaxy
  5. Download and Use Roles from Ansible Galaxy

Ansible Vault

  1. Introduction to Ansible Vault
  2. Encrypt and Decrypt Playbooks
  3. Use File as Password for Ansible Playbooks
  4. Ansible Vault Commands

Jinja 2 Templates

  1. Introduction to Jinja2 Template
  2. Create Jinja2 Template
  3. Template with Looping
  4. Template with Conditions

Linux Administration

  1. Managing Packages
  2. Managing Users and Groups
  3. Managing Partition
  4. Starting and Stopping Services
  5. Managing SSH Keys 

Windows Administration

  1. Install and Uninstall MSI/EXE
  2. Download Software 
  3. Managing Users
  4. Managing Windows Partition
  5. Managing Services
TENHO INTERESSE

Cursos Relacionados

Curso Ansible Red Hat Basics Automation Technical Foundation

16 horas

Curso Terraform Deploying to Oracle Cloud Infrastructure

24 Horas

Curso Ansible Linux Automation with Ansible

24 horas

Ansible Overview of Ansible architecture

16h

Advanced Automation: Ansible Best Practices

32h